Combustion of hydrocarbons such as pentane (C,H,,) produces carbon dioxide, a "greenhouse gas." Greenhouse gases in the Earth's atmosphere can trap the 131 12 Sun's heat, raising the average temperature of the Earth. For this reason there has been a great deal of international discussion about whether to regulate the production of carbon dioxide. 1. Write a balanced chemical equation, including physical state symbols, for the combustion of liquid pentane into gaseous carbon dioxide and gaseous water. ローロ do x10 2. Suppose 0.210 kg of pentane are burned in air at a pressure of exactly 1 atmn and a temperature of 14.0 °C. Calculate the volume of carbon dioxide gas that is produced.
